Добрый день
нужно в ST обработать записи исторических данных
согласно HELP написал программу но пишет ошибку при компиляции, подскажите где я неправ
вот сама программа
TYPE
Point : DATABASE_OBJECT(CDBHistoric)
Id : INT;
Time : DATE;
FormattedValue : STRING;
END_DATABASE_OBJECT;
END_TYPE
PROGRAM ttt
VAR NOCACHE
Pts AT %S(SELECT "Id", "Time", "FormattedValue" FROM "CDBHistoric" WHERE "Time" < {OPC 'H'} ORDER by "Time" DESC) : RESULTSET OF Point;
END_VAR
WHILE Pts.Valid DO
Pts.Next();
END_WHILE;
END_PROGRAM
сообщение об ошибке следующее
Tag error: table does not match RESULTSET data type
- Обязательно представиться на русском языке кириллицей (заполнить поле "Имя").
- Фиктивные имена мы не приветствуем. Ивановых и Пупкиных здесь уже достаточно.
- Не надо писать свой вопрос в первую попавшуюся тему - всегда лучше создать новую тему.
- За поиск, предложение и обсуждение пиратского ПО и средств взлома - бан без предупреждения. Непонятно? - Читать здесь.
- Рекламу и частные объявления "куплю/продам/есть халтура" мы не размещаем ни на каких условиях.
- Перед тем как что-то написать - читать здесь, а затем здесь и здесь.
- Не надо писать в ЛС администраторам свои технические вопросы. Администраторы форума отлично знают как работает форум, а не все-все контроллеры, о которых тут пишут.
GeoScada запрос к CDBHistoric из ST
Модераторы: Глоб.модераторы, Специалисты SE
-
- здесь недавно
- Сообщения: 12
- Зарегистрирован: 01 окт 2021, 14:44
- Имя: Андрей
- город/регион: Нижний Новгород
-
- здесь недавно
- Сообщения: 12
- Зарегистрирован: 01 окт 2021, 14:44
- Имя: Андрей
- город/регион: Нижний Новгород